Description
This is not a standard village house. It is a 235 m² property with genuine scale, multiple terraces, and structural flexibility, located in one of the quieter, more authentic parts of the Alpujarra.
Located in Cojáyar (Murtas), this property offers a combination rarely found at this price point: size, natural light, outdoor space, and the ability to reconfigure or expand depending on your objective.
The main living accommodation is distributed over three levels and includes three bedrooms, two bathrooms, a living room with fireplace, a spacious kitchen, and multiple terraces with open views across the village and surrounding mountains. The south-west orientation ensures consistent natural light throughout the day.
What sets this property apart from competing listings is its lower level and upper floor potential.
The lower ground floor (currently old corrals) provides a significant volume of usable space that can be converted into additional accommodation, a separate guest unit, workshop, or rental unit. Most properties at this price level do not offer this level of expansion.
The upper floor features a large open-plan space with panoramic views. This can function as a second living area, studio, or workspace, depending on the buyer profile.
Compared to coastal properties under €100,000, where space is limited and layouts are fixed, this property offers flexibility and long-term upside. The trade-off is location: this is a rural, quiet environment, not a tourist coastal zone.
Condition-wise, the property requires cleaning and cosmetic updating, but there are no known structural issues. This positions it as a manageable project rather than a full renovation.
From a lifestyle perspective, this is suited to buyers looking for space, privacy, and a slower pace of living. It also works for buyers seeking a creative retreat, part-time residence, or a property they can gradually improve.
